Niger Delta Minister, Momoh, Commissions 91 kWp Solar Powered Mini-Grid in Okpokunou Community, Powered By Saf-Aga
In a historic moment for the Niger Delta region, Engr. Abubakar Momoh (FNSE), Hon. Minister of Niger Delta Development, officially commissioned the 91 kWp Solar Powered Mini-Grid in Okpokunou Community, Burutu Local Government Area of Delta State. The groundbreaking initiative, spearheaded by Saf-Aga Renewable Energy Limited, marks a pivotal step in the fight against energy poverty and a giant leap towards sustainable development in the region.
Saf-Aga Renewable Energy Limited led by its MD/CEO Dr. Godbless Safugha and its technical partners has achieved a remarkable feat with the commissioning of the Okpokunou Mini-Grid, a scalable 230 kWp capacity system initially serving 330 households. This initiative aligns seamlessly with the company’s vision of establishing green villages throughout the Niger Delta, fostering economic growth, education, and healthcare through the provision of sustainable energy.
Hon. Minister Abubakar Momoh expressed his commendation for the initiative, emphasizing the importance of replicating such projects by private organizations across the Niger Delta and the entire nation. He passionately urged Nigerians to embrace clean and renewable energy solutions, highlighting the promising prospects the Okpokunou Mini-Grid holds for the people of the Niger Delta Region.
According to the Minister, this marks a significant milestone in the pursuit of innovative and eco-friendly energy solutions. He highlighted that the Niger Delta, with its vast potential and resources, deserves to be at the forefront of sustainable energy initiatives. Beyond its role in illuminating homes, the Okpokunou Mini-Grid paves the way for improved education, healthcare, and economic activities in the communities.
The Minister reiterated the Ministry of Niger Delta Development’s unwavering commitment to collaborating with Saf-Aga Renewable Energy Limited for the expansion of their reach to additional communities in the Nine Niger Delta states. He emphasized the need for collective efforts to address the energy challenges faced by the region and called on other private organizations to follow the example set by Saf-Aga in promoting clean and renewable energy solutions.
The official commissioning ceremony was attended by government officials, community leaders, and representatives from Saf-Aga Renewable Energy Limited, showcasing the collaborative spirit and commitment to a sustainable, energy-rich future for the Niger Delta region.
